## Changelog — Ticktrace 1.9

### Renamed: DRIFT_API_TOKEN
During the cron drift investigation we found plugins confusing this variable with the metrics token, so it has been renamed to indicate it authorizes drift-report uploads specifically. Plugin authors must read the new name from 1.9 onward; the old name is ignored without warning. Sample env files in the SDK are updated. In your deployment env file, the drift-report upload secret is set on the next line.

env line for fawef-taguf: VAULT_KEY13=a9695905a9a90

# Building Access — Cleaning Crew

Fernhollow Services cleans Pavilion B nightly, 21:00–23:30. Crew of three, led by supervisor Ilka Brandt. They sign the night register at reception; check names against the Fernhollow roster sheet. No access to the records room or lab wing — ever. Lost register pages go to the duty manager. The crew enters via the rear service door using the code below.

door code, yagap-bahof: bdg-O-05

TURN-208: Gatevale turnstile counters at the Merrow Field pilot double-count when a rotation reverses mid-cycle. Attendance totals drift roughly 2% high per event. The debounce window fix is implemented, reviewed by Ilsa, and soak-tested across two simulated match days without drift. Ready for your cut; the candidate build is identified below.

trace token, tagag-tafog: htk6_5ed18c

Subject: Quickstore 4.2 — bloom filter now fronts the KV layer

Plugin authors: starting with this release, Quickstore places a bloom filter ahead of the key-value store. Negative lookups return faster; false positives fall through safely. No API changes are required on your side. Verify your plugin against the staging build referenced below.

session token of fahif-tadup = htk3_9c7